Trapdoor Spider Removal Questions
What are trapdoor spiders? Trapdoor spiders are ground-dwelling arachnids that create camouflaged burrows with a hinged door to ambush prey.
Why remove trapdoor spiders? Removal helps prevent potential bites and reduces the presence of these spiders around homes and properties.
How are trapdoor spiders removed? Removal typically involves carefully locating and safely extracting the spiders and their burrows from the property.
Are trapdoor spiders dangerous? While generally not aggressive, trapdoor spiders can bite if provoked, so removal is recommended for safety.
